[Cluster-devel] [PATCH 05/12] gfs2: Remove minor gfs2_journaled_truncate inefficiencies

Andreas Gruenbacher agruenba at redhat.com
Fri Dec 22 14:35:00 UTC 2017


First, this function truncates the file in chunks.  When the original
file size isn't block aligned, each chunk that is truncated will remain
be misaligned.  This is inefficient.

Second, this function doesn't recognize where holes are, so it loops
through them.  For each chunk of a hole, it creates a new transaction.
At least avoid creating another transactions whe the current one is
still empty.  (An better fix would be to skip large holes, of course.)

diff --git a/fs/gfs2/bmap.c b/fs/gfs2/bmap.c
index 963117f704bf..921bf33faa96 100644
--- a/fs/gfs2/bmap.c
+++ b/fs/gfs2/bmap.c
@@ -1003,11 +1003,25 @@ static int gfs2_journaled_truncate(struct inode *inode, u64 oldsize, u64 newsize
 	int error;
 
 	while (oldsize != newsize) {
+		struct gfs2_trans *tr;
+		unsigned int offs;
+
 		chunk = oldsize - newsize;
 		if (chunk > max_chunk)
 			chunk = max_chunk;
+
+		offs = oldsize & ~PAGE_MASK;
+		if (offs && chunk > PAGE_SIZE)
+			chunk = offs + ((chunk - offs) & PAGE_MASK);
+
 		truncate_pagecache(inode, oldsize - chunk);
 		oldsize -= chunk;
+
+		/* XXX Is this check sufficient? */
+		tr = current->journal_info;
+		if (!tr->tr_num_revoke)
+			continue;
+
 		gfs2_trans_end(sdp);
 		error = gfs2_trans_begin(sdp, RES_DINODE, GFS2_JTRUNC_REVOKES);
 		if (error)
